AutoBE

(Be the first to comment)
更快速地打造可靠的後端伺服器。AutoBE AI 自動化 TypeScript、NestJS、Prisma、Postgres 的程式碼、Schema、API 及測試。 0
訪問

What is AutoBE?

打造穩健、可供正式上線的後端伺服器,往往需要重複編碼、仔細設計資料結構、定義介面,以及進行全面的測試。這個過程需要精準度,並且耗費大量時間。如果可以簡化大部分這類工作,讓您可以專注於核心邏輯,同時由智慧代理程式處理基礎架構和驗證,那會怎麼樣呢?

隆重推出 AutoBE,這是一款專為使用 TypeScript、NestJS、Prisma 和 Postgres 進行後端伺服器開發而設計的 Vibe 編碼代理程式。AutoBE 會分析您的需求,並自動產生可執行、功能完善的後端程式碼,從而大幅加速您的開發流程,同時維持高品質和可靠性的標準。

主要功能

AutoBE 透過一系列專業代理程式運作,這些代理程式以反覆運算的方式協同工作,將您的需求轉換為經過驗證的程式碼。

  • 需求分析 📋:Analyze 代理程式會處理您的對話式輸入,將需求建構成清晰的規格。它會找出不明確之處,並提出有針對性的問題,以確保在開始開發之前充分理解。

  • 資料庫結構描述產生 💾:Prisma 代理程式會採用需求規格,並以 Prisma 格式產生您的資料庫結構描述。它包括透過內建的 Prisma 編譯器進行自動驗證,並產生詳細的 ERD 文件,確保堅固的資料基礎。

  • API 介面設計 🔗:根據規格和資料庫結構描述,Interface 代理程式會使用 OpenAPI 結構描述設計精確的 API 介面。這種結構化的方法可確保一致性,並為您的 NestJS 控制器和 DTO 產生經過驗證的 TypeScript 程式碼。

  • 自動化測試 ✅:Test 代理程式會為每個 API 介面建立全面的端對端測試套件。它會分析依賴關係以正確地排序測試,確保您產生的程式碼如預期般運作並遵守業務規則。

  • 程式碼實現 🛠️:Realize 代理程式會綜合先前所有階段的輸出,以編寫每個 API 端點的功能服務程式碼。此程式碼會受到來自 TypeScript 編譯器和自動化測試套件的持續回饋迴圈影響,從而確保可靠性。

AutoBE 的流程建立在持續回饋迴圈的基礎上。編譯器錯誤、OpenAPI 驗證失敗和測試執行結果會回饋到 AI 系統中,從而在每個步驟中實現自我修正和改進。這種反覆運算的方法,受到螺旋模型的啟發,確保產生的程式碼不僅功能完善,而且安全可靠。

使用案例

  • 快速啟動新專案: 根據您的初始需求,快速產生新應用程式的基礎後端結構(資料庫結構描述、API 介面、基本服務程式碼、測試),讓您的團隊可以更快地專注於複雜的業務邏輯。

  • 快速實施功能: 描述一項新功能,例如電子商務模組或佈告欄系統,然後讓 AutoBE 產生必要的資料庫變更、API 端點和服務程式碼,與您現有的 AutoBE 產生專案無縫整合。

  • 實現全端自動化: 使用 AutoBE 的 Interface 代理程式產生的 OpenAPI 文件作為工具(例如 @agentica,用於建立與您的後端互動的 AI 聊天機器人,或 @autoview,用於產生前端應用程式)的輸入,從而實現真正的自動化全端工作流程。


AutoBE 旨在成為您後端開發過程中可靠的合作夥伴。透過自動化結構化的重複性任務,並在每個階段整合嚴格的驗證,它可以幫助您更有效率地建立高品質的後端應用程式。


More information on AutoBE

Launched
Pricing Model
Free
Starting Price
Global Rank
Follow
Month Visit
<5k
Tech used
AutoBE was manually vetted by our editorial team and was first featured on 2025-05-24.
Aitoolnet Featured banner
Related Searches

AutoBE 替代方案

更多 替代方案
  1. Autonomy AI:您的 AI 自主前端開發者。將設計稿轉換為程式碼,學習您的程式碼庫,並提升團隊生產力。

  2. Line0: 運用 AI 進行 Express.js 後端協同程式設計。更快速且更有信心地建構穩健、可供正式環境使用的服務。具備程式碼生成、最佳實務和 GitHub 同步等功能。

  3. Generate front-end, back-end and database.Other tools give you a beautiful front-end window and leave you to find your own back-end plumbing and database foundation. With AutoCoder.cc, you get the whole structure—secure, functional, and ready to scale.From your idea to a live, fully functional application (Front-end, Back-end, and Database)—delivered seamlessly without writing a single line of code or integrating a single third-party tool. Stop piecing together a prototype. Launch a real product.

  4. VoltAgent:用於建構強大、客製化 AI 代理程式的開源 TypeScript 框架。取得控制權與靈活性,整合 LLM、工具與資料。

  5. EasyCode 是一個本機端的一站式 AI 平台,旨在協助您在電腦上建構客製化的網路應用程式。您只需描述您的構想,EasyCode 便能運用 AI 技術為您建構出來。